Rainham (Essex) station prioritizes passenger comfort with a number of useful facilities. Ticketing is seamless with electronic ticket machines and the added convenience of collecting pre-purchased tickets. The ticket office operates on weekdays from 06:15 to 09:50—ideal for early morning travelers. Accessibility is a notable feature; the station proudly offers step-free access across its premises. There are five accessible parking spaces to ensure easy access for those with mobility challenges. Induction loops and accessible toilets located on Platform 2 cater to the needs of all travelers.
Though lacking a waiting room or onsite shops, Platform 2 features refreshment facilities for that caffeine kick pre-journey, and free public Wi-Fi keeps you connected on the go. While there's no ATM machine, secure bicycle storage with CCTV protection is available for cyclists. Safety is prioritized with CCTV monitoring throughout the site.

Church Stretton station is equipped with ticket machines making it easy to collect pre-purchased tickets. These machines are accessible and accept major credit and debit cards, although they don't process payments in cash. There is no staffed ticket office, so passengers requiring assistance for ticket queries can use the helpline by calling 0800 200 6060.
For traveler assurance, the station is equipped with CCTV. While the station lacks waiting rooms and refreshment facilities, it does provide seating areas for a bit of respite. Please note, the station does not have toilets or baby-changing facilities. Bicycle enthusiasts will find 4 Sheffield stands available for parking bikes, though cycle hire facilities aren't provided. And for motorists, while parking is free, there are very limited allocated spaces with just two marked as accessible.
Access to the platforms at Church Stretton is partially step-free, classified as Category B2. Passengers can move between platforms via a footbridge with steps, or a longer route avoiding steps. This station does not have ticket barriers to navigate, making movement less restricted. While there are accessible ticket machines and ramp provisions for train access, you won't find accessible toilets or dedicated help points here.
Those looking to continue their journey from Church Stretton will find a rail replacement bus service conveniently located in the station car park behind the Hereford bound platform if needed.
